bug-gnustep
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ug #65844] 4 test files abort on some architectures


From: Yavor Doganov
Subject: [bug #65844] 4 test files abort on some architectures
Date: Thu, 6 Jun 2024 06:26:53 -0400 (EDT)

URL:
  <https://savannah.gnu.org/bugs/?65844>

                 Summary: 4 test files abort on some architectures
                   Group: GNUstep
               Submitter: yavor
               Submitted: Thu 06 Jun 2024 01:26:53 PM EEST
                Category: Gui/AppKit
                Severity: 3 - Normal
              Item Group: Bug
                  Status: None
                 Privacy: Public
             Assigned to: None
             Open/Closed: Open
         Discussion Lock: Any


    _______________________________________________________

Follow-up Comments:


-------------------------------------------------------
Date: Thu 06 Jun 2024 01:26:53 PM EEST By: Yavor Doganov <yavor>
On Debian, for GUI version 0.31.0, 4 test files abort on most architectures
(arm64, armel, armhf, hppa, loong64, powerpc, ppc64, ppc64el, riscv64, s390x,
sparc64 and probably alpha where it is not yet built and m68k/sh4 where the
testsuite is not being run):


Testing buttonCell.m...
Running gui/GSXib5KeyedUnarchiver/buttonCell.m...
Start set:       buttonCell.m:13 ... GSXib5KeyedUnarchiver NSButtonCell tests
2024-06-05 22:19:25.695 buttonCell[854:854] Did not find correct version of
backend (libgnustep-back-031.bundle), falling back to std
(libgnustep-back.bundle).
2024-06-05 22:19:25.696 buttonCell[854:854] NSApplication.m:306  Assertion
failed in initialize_gnustep_backend.  Unable to find backend back
Skipped set:       buttonCell.m 22 ... It looks like GNUstep backend is not
yet installed
End set:         buttonCell.m:57 ... GSXib5KeyedUnarchiver NSButtonCell tests
Failed file:     buttonCell.m aborted without running all tests!


The culprit is missing return from main; patch attached.






    _______________________________________________________
File Attachments:


-------------------------------------------------------
Name: 0001-Add-missing-return-statement.patch  Size: 2KiB
<https://file.savannah.gnu.org/file/0001-Add-missing-return-statement.patch?file_id=56141>

    AGPL NOTICE

These attachments are served by Savane. You can download the corresponding
source code of Savane at
https://git.savannah.nongnu.org/cgit/administration/savane.git/snapshot/savane-67b04ef8737d6f02579af43d702ebae34ebfcbfd.tar.gz

    _______________________________________________________

Reply to this item at:

  <https://savannah.gnu.org/bugs/?65844>

_______________________________________________
Message sent via Savannah
https://savannah.gnu.org/




reply via email to

[Prev in Thread] Current Thread [Next in Thread]